How many space missions require the skills of Astrometrics or Science? Indeed, many of them do! So, why not equip everyone aboard with the ability to acquire these skills just by being on your ship? That's the power of Columbia, The Second Warp Five Ship. When facing a dilemma, you may discard a card from hand to give any mission team member either of these skills. Moreover, the personnel doesn't immediately forget the skill when the dilemma is gone. Instead, they retain it until the end of the mission attempt, which means they have the skill if/when needed to meet mission requirements! Even better, this is not limited to once per turn, or even once per dilemma. Just remember to keep plenty of cards in your hand, so you may use this ability when needed!
Imagine how easy it becomes to Investigate Stalled Ship aboard Columbia: You start with a crew that may even completely lack the skills of Astrometrics and Science. During your mission attempt, however, you face a dilemma with at least four cards in your hand, and by executing the special text on Columbia four times, you have all of the skills necessary to complete the mission! Be wary, though, of those skill-tracking opponents who may be wise to your ploy. If they know you do not possess the skills without executing Columbia's text, they know they shouldn't give you any dilemmas at all.
The fun aboard Columbia doesn't stop with skill enhancements. As with many other Starfleet affiliation cards, Columbia includes game text that encourages you to complete a space mission before any planet mission. If you do so, Columbia's attributes are increased by one for the rest of the game.
Its low cost of four counters, easy staffing requirements, and special abilities all make Columbia a natural fit for many Starfleet affiliation decks. But wait, that's not all... check out the Columbia's commander, and see how this ship can be even more appealing!
